Power
Her heels, impossibly thin and impractically tall just like her, sound like wealth echoing off the windows. “Do you know who I am,” she slurs, “The mayor will hear about this. You’re nothing in this town.” I nod and the alcohol conspires with me to pull her from the ballroom, where I catch the eye of the bouncer who gently steers her away. I smooth my rented designer dress and adjust my headset before returning to the room. Discreetly, I let the celebrity host know that all was taken care of. She compliments first my efficiency, then my chunky, practical heels. When I tell her they were from a second-hand shop, she insists I take her there one day.
